Betbricks7 announced as new principal team partner for West Indies vs India T20I Series

ST. JOHN’S, Antigua – Cricket West Indies (CWI) has announced Betbricks7 as the new principal team partner for the five-match T20I Series against India. The Betbricks7 logo is being displayed on the front of the West Indies playing jersey throughout the five-match Kuhl Stylish Fans T20I Series powered by Black and White. The series bowled off on Thursday 3 August at the Brian Lara Cricket Academy in Trinidad.

Dominic Warne, CWI’s Commercial Director, said: “We’re very happy to welcome Betbricks7 into Cricket West Indies’ family of sponsors as the Title Sponsor for the West Indies for the T20I Series against India. This series will be filled with entertainment for all fans in the stands as well as to the hundreds of millions watching around the globe on TV and on their devices. Betbricks7 will be present on the front of the iconic West Indies maroon and gold shirt as the world follows this T20I Series.”

Akash Khanna, Chief Marketing Officer, BetBricks7, said: “We are excited to be the Title Sponsor of the West Indies cricket team for the West Indies vs India T20I series in 2023. Cricket is hugely important to Caribbean heritage, culture, community and youth development. At BetBricks7, we have always been passionate about sports and the thrill it brings to millions of fans worldwide. The sponsorship comes as the West Indies step onto the field against India ready for the much-anticipated T20I Series, and they carry with them the hopes and dreams of millions of fans. Joining forces with the West Indies team for the T20I series against India allows us to bring that passion to the forefront and be a part of an exceptional cricketing experience.”

Following Thursday’s first Kuhl Stylish Fans T20I powered by Black and White, the series moves to the Guyana National Stadium for the second and third matches on Sunday 6 August and Tuesday 8 August. The fourth and fifth matches will be at Broward County Stadium, Lauderhill, Florida on Saturday 12 August and Sunday 13 August.

About Cricket West Indies

Cricket West Indies (CWI) takes great pride and responsibility in growing, guiding and organising cricket throughout the English-speaking Caribbean countries which form the West Indies, represented internationally by the West Indies men’s, women’s and age-group teams.

The West Indies international team is unique in cricket and in international sport. It is the only team in cricket that represents a group of nations, drawing on the strength, skills and passion of each nation to unite through cricket and take on the world.

CWI is the governing body for all professional and amateur cricket in the region, from the West Indies international teams  and home series to regional tournaments such as the West Indies Championship (4-Day), the one-day CG United Super50 Cup and the women’s T20 Blaze.
